German article about Ocon:

http://m.faz.net/aktuell/sport/form...ia-bei-formel-1-gp-in-baku-2017-15072857.html

- one of the few rookies (if not only) who can handle the new faster cars
- mechanics at force india prefered him to wehrlein because he was a listener and learner while wehrlein was trying to tell them how to do their job
- comes from a poor background, father was mechanic, mother a housewife
- sold their house and lived in a trailer to finance their sons career (damn they had a lot of trust)
- had no significant sponsors until his F3 victory
- at one point even applied for a McDonald's job
- too tall for F1
- Nasr offered 5 times the money but they still chose Ocon because they trusted him to bring in the money through results
